Trip Overview

Embarking on a 203.5-mile journey from Avis, PA to Bristol, PA, this route will take approximately 3 hours and 59 minutes to complete. Primarily utilizing the Pennsylvania Turnpike Northeast Extension, Keystone Shortway, and Pennsylvania Turnpike, it's a manageable drive that can easily be accomplished in a single day. With an estimated fuel cost of $34, this trip offers a straightforward experience through Pennsylvania's Northeast region. The drive is characterized by a mix of road types, making it a practical option for those looking for an efficient travel day.

Expect about $12.94 in tolls one way, starting with Pennsylvania Turnpike. Most Northeast and Midwest toll agencies accept E-ZPass; in the West and Texas, transponders like TxTag or FasTrak apply. If you do not have a transponder, cashless tolling plates will mail a bill to the vehicle's registered address — usually with a surcharge, so a rental-car toll pass is often cheaper than paying by mail.
